Disclosed are magnetic recording media having excellent running durability and electromagnetic characteristics and comprising a lower layer comprising a magnetic powder or nonmagnetic powder and a binder and one or more upper magnetic layers comprising a ferromagnetic powder and a binder in this order on a nonmagnetic support. In one mode, at least said lower layer comprises a binder comprising polyurethane resin having a glass transition temperature ranging from 100 to 200° C., and a magnetic layer positioned as the topmost layer among said upper magnetic layers comprises 5 to 1,000 surface protrusions of 10 to 20 nm in height per 100 mum2 on the surface thereof. In another mode, at least a magnetic layer positioned as the topmost layer among said upper magnetic layers comprises a binder comprising polyurethane resin having a glass transition temperature ranging from 100 to 200° C., and said magnetic layer positioned as the topmost layer among the upper magnetic layers comprises 5 to 1,000 surface protrusions of 10 to 20 nm in height per 100 mum2 on the surface thereof.
